Output 03088a37e4f139f7bc232b59df082d9eb6ce553d86481f6e2ef548ba7f706ddc:1

value
59983968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a05c506b81059b2d22474a18bf5cfc436d57aa OP_EQUAL
address
3GhUr45cFcUwYJr7GKGvWB12EzELFUEfVY
transaction
03088a37e4f139f7bc232b59df082d9eb6ce553d86481f6e2ef548ba7f706ddc
confirmations
368832
spent
true